Assyrian soldiers using siege-engines and battering-rams during the Siege of Lachish. Wall panel from the South West Palace of Sennacherib (room 36, no 6), Nineveh, Neo-Assyrian, 700BC-692BC. AN 124906 
Location British Museum/London/Great Britain
